Microsoft SQL Server

Aus HB9FDZ
Version vom 19. August 2025, 09:52 Uhr von Thomas (Diskussion | Beiträge)
(Unterschied) ← Nächstältere Version | Aktuelle Version (Unterschied) | Nächstjüngere Version → (Unterschied)
Zur Navigation springen Zur Suche springen

Installation und Konfiguration von SQL Server Express 2022

[Bearbeiten | Quelltext bearbeiten]

1. Installation

[Bearbeiten | Quelltext bearbeiten]
  • Lade den Installer von der offiziellen Microsoft-Seite herunter.
  • Starte die Installation im Benutzermodus oder Basic-Modus.
  • Wähle eine Named Instance (z. B. SQLEXPRESS).

2. TCP/IP aktivieren

[Bearbeiten | Quelltext bearbeiten]
  • Öffne den SQL Server Configuration Manager.
  • Navigiere zu: SQL Server-Netzwerkkonfiguration > Protokolle für SQLEXPRESS
  • Aktiviere TCP/IP per Rechtsklick → Aktivieren.

3. Port 1433 festlegen

[Bearbeiten | Quelltext bearbeiten]
  • Doppelklick auf TCP/IP → Reiter IP-Adressen.
  • Scrolle ganz nach unten zu IPAll.
    • TCP Dynamic Ports → leer lassen
    • TCP Port1433 eintragen
  • Optional: Bei anderen IP-Einträgen ebenfalls TCP Port = 1433 setzen.

4. SQL-Dienst neu starten

[Bearbeiten | Quelltext bearbeiten]
  • Gehe zu: SQL Server-Dienste > SQL Server (SQLEXPRESS)
  • Rechtsklick → Neu starten

5. Firewall-Regel hinzufügen

[Bearbeiten | Quelltext bearbeiten]
  • Öffne die Windows Defender Firewall mit erweiterter Sicherheit.
  • Erstelle eine eingehende Regel:
    • Programm: sqlservr.exe (Pfad z. B. C:\Program Files\Microsoft SQL Server\MSSQL15.SQLEXPRESS\MSSQL\Binn\sqlservr.exe)
    • Port: TCP 1433
    • Profil: Domäne, Privat, Öffentlich (je nach Bedarf)
    • Aktion: Zulassen

6. Verbindung testen

[Bearbeiten | Quelltext bearbeiten]
  • Mit PowerShell:
Test-NetConnection -ComputerName <Server-IP> -Port 1433
  • Alternativ mit Telnet (falls aktiviert):
telnet <Server-IP> 1433

7. Zugriff mit HeidiSQL prüfen

[Bearbeiten | Quelltext bearbeiten]
  • Verbindungstyp: Microsoft SQL Server (TCP/IP)
  • Hostname/IP: <Server-IP>
  • Port: 1433
  • Benutzername & Passwort: entsprechend konfigurieren
  • Nach erfolgreicher Verbindung sollte die Datenbank sichtbar sein.

Falls Telnet nicht installiert ist, kann es über CMD aktiviert werden:

dism /online /Enable-Feature /FeatureName:TelnetClient

ToDo: SQL Server Express 2022

[Bearbeiten | Quelltext bearbeiten]
  • [ ] Installer herunterladen und ausführen
  • [ ] Named Instance erstellen (z. B. SQLEXPRESS)
  • [ ] TCP/IP aktivieren im Configuration Manager
  • [ ] Port 1433 unter IPAll setzen
  • [ ] SQL-Dienst neu starten
  • [ ] Firewall-Regel für sqlservr.exe und Port 1433 erstellen
  • [ ] Verbindung mit PowerShell oder Telnet testen
  • [ ] Zugriff mit HeidiSQL prüfen
  • [ ] Telnet-Client ggf. über CMD aktivieren